Changes between Version 26 and Version 27 of Doc-MIPS-Archi-Asm-kernel


Ignore:
Timestamp:
Sep 21, 2020, 6:39:41 AM (5 years ago)
Author:
franck
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• Doc-MIPS-Archi-Asm-kernel

    v26 v27  
    140140
    141141
    142 Le mode d'adressage définit la manière dont le processeur calcule les adresses de la mémoire pour y accéder en lecture ou en écriture. Il n'existe qu'un seul et unique mode d’adressage pour le MIPS32. Il consiste à effectuer la somme entre le contenu d'un registre général (GPR) `$i`, défini dans l'instruction, et d'un déplacement qui est une valeur immédiate signée, nommé IMD16 sur 16 bits (de -32768 à +32767), contenue également dans l'instruction:
     142Le mode d'adressage définit la manière dont le processeur calcule les adresses de la mémoire pour y accéder en lecture ou en écriture. Il n'existe qu'un seul et unique mode d’adressage pour le MIPS32. Il consiste à effectuer la somme entre le contenu d'un registre général (GPR) `$i`, défini dans l'instruction, et d'un déplacement qui est une valeur immédiate signée, nommé `IMD16` sur 16 bits (de -32768 à +32767), contenue également dans l'instruction:
    143143
    144144{{{
    145 adresse = `$i` + IMD16
     145adresse = $i + IMD16
    146146}}}
    147147